In all seriousness, the wedding band is a symbol of love and dedication to only one other. It means that two people love each other so much that they have pledged to stay together no matter what happens - no disease, no disability, nothing. There will be times when love doesn t seem possible; two people will not get along every hour of every day. But love is different; if one temporarily doesn t like their spouse, that feeling passes and love overcomes all.
